Thank you to both of you! I was lurking on this forum for a bit before taking the plunge :-). We started litter training on Day 1. We've had 1 accident in the past week, which I think is awesome, and I now seem to realize they have the same potty times as young puppies. All in all I believe we've been doing pretty well, in her cage she seems to do a pretty good job. Today was the first day in a week that she slept all day...lol. I would walk in, check on her and she was just lazing around. She's hit it off with the dogs and they're beyond amazing with her. My husband is even enjoying her stating that she's so clean and fun (in which case I reminded him that his brother was a poor caretaker and to be blamed for the mess/smell!). He's even amazed at how odorless my office and her cage are ;-). BTW whoever recommended Yesterday's News for litter THANK YOU! I still don't know what her urine/feces actually smells like and we're using the unscented version!
